SINGAPORE (The Straits Times/Asia News Network): A Singaporean has been appointed as the International Monetary Fund's (IMF) chief information officer (CIO) and information technology department director.
Shirin Hamid (pic) is expected to assume her new role on Jan 4 next year and will succeed Edward Anderson, who left the fund in June.
